Coast Guard Enters Cuba Waters for Rescue
Associated Press
MIAMI —
A U.S. Coast Guard cutter entered Cuban waters early today to rescue an American yachtsman whose powerless 30-foot sailboat was drifting toward Cuba, a spokesman said.
“We notified them that we were going in. We don’t do it very often,” Lt. Cmdr. Jim Simpson said, adding that the Cuban government made no objection to the rescue about 10 miles northwest of the island.
